#ifndef _NSPIMGHDR_H_ |
||||
#define _NSPIMGHDR_H_ |
||||
|
||||
/* This file describes the header format for the single image. The image is broken
|
||||
up into several pieces. The image contains this header plus 1 or more sections. |
||||
Each section contains a binary block that could be a kernel, filesystem, etc. The |
||||
only garentee for this is that the very first section MUST be executable. Meaning |
||||
that the bootloader will be able to take the address of the header start, add the |
||||
header size, and execute that binary block. The header has its own checksum. It |
||||
starts hdr_size-4 bytes from the start of the header. |
||||
*/ |
||||
|
||||
struct nsp_img_hdr_head |
||||
{ |
||||
unsigned int magic; /* Magic number to identify this image header */ |
||||
unsigned int boot_offset; /* Offset from start of header to kernel code. */ |
||||
unsigned int flags; /* Image flags. */ |
||||
unsigned int hdr_version; /* Version of this header. */ |
||||
unsigned int hdr_size; /* The complete size of all portions of the header */ |
||||
unsigned int prod_id; /* This product id */ |
||||
unsigned int rel_id; /* Which release this is */ |
||||
unsigned int version; /* name-MMM.nnn.ooo-rxx => 0xMMnnooxx. See comment
|
||||
below */ |
||||
unsigned int image_size; /* Image size (including header) */ |
||||
unsigned int info_offset; /* Offset from start of header to info block */ |
||||
unsigned int sect_info_offset; /* Offset from start of header to section desc */ |
||||
unsigned int chksum_offset; /* Offset from start of header to chksum block */ |
||||
// unsigned int pad1;
|
||||
}; |
||||
|
||||
/* The patch id is a machine readable value that takes the normal patch level, and encodes
|
||||
the correct numbers inside of it. The format of the patches are name-MM.NN.oo-rxx.bin. |
||||
Convert MM, NN, oo, and xx into hex, and encode them as 0xMMNNooxx. Thus: |
||||
att-1.2.18-r14.bin => 0x0102120e */ |
